Vehicle & ECU specifications

Exact vehicle, engine and ECU identifiers this calibration file is written for. Cross-check against your ECU before flashing.

Vehicle make Ford
Vehicle model Focus
Model year 2009
Displacement 1.6 L
Fuel / Induction Petrol
Factory power 77.2 kW (105 HP)
ECU manufacturer Bosch
ECU hardware K010132986AA
Calibration stage Original (Factory)
Cylinder capacity 1596 CC
Compression ratio 11,0 : 1
Bore × Stroke 79,0 X 81,4 mm
OEM engine code SHDA

About this calibration file

This is the factory (original) ECU calibration for the 2009 Ford Focus 1.6L Petrol, extracted from a genuine stock control unit. Use it as a verified backup before flashing any performance tune, or as a reference when recovering an ECU from a failed write.

This file matches a Bosch ECU with hardware number K010132986AA. Verify both identifiers in your flashing tool before writing — an ID mismatch is the most common cause of a bricked ECU.
